[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[E-devel] Debian Sid, imlib2, lmlib2_loaders, debain/control



On Sun, May 28, 2006 at 04:00:14PM +0200, Grzegorz Andrelczyk wrote:
> Hello.
> 
> There is dependency problem in Imlib2 and Imlib2_loadres. Both packages
> are set to depend on xlibs-dev, but xlibs-dev is depreceated. Even worse
> xlibs-dev was removed from repositoris probably during transition to
> Xorg 7.0. At least it looks like that. Now there is one package x-dev,
> and a lot of x11proto*dev packages.
> 
> I sugest to upgreade/correct debian/control files for imlib2 and
> imlib2-loaders.
> 
[...]

Thanks for pointing it out.

Attached are two patches which should solve both problems. I think
imlib2 only needs x11proto-core-dev and x11proto-xext-dev but I might be
mistaken.
imlib2-loaders however need none of them because imlib2-dev already
depends on them.

Falko
--- control.org	2006-05-28 21:33:15.000000000 +0200
+++ control	2006-05-28 21:36:50.000000000 +0200
@@ -2,7 +2,7 @@
 Section: libs
 Priority: optional
 Maintainer: Laurence J. Lane <ljlane@debian.org>
-Build-Depends: libjpeg62-dev, libttf-dev, libpng3-dev | libpng2-dev | libpng-dev, libtiff4-dev | libtiff-dev, zlib1g-dev, libungif4-dev | libungif3g-dev | giflib3g-dev, xlibs-dev, libfreetype6-dev | freetype2-dev, libbz2-dev, libltdl3-dev, automake1.7 | automaken, libtool, debhelper (>= 4.0)
+Build-Depends: libjpeg62-dev, libttf-dev, libpng3-dev | libpng2-dev | libpng-dev, libtiff4-dev | libtiff-dev, zlib1g-dev, libungif4-dev | libungif3g-dev | giflib3g-dev, x11proto-core-dev | xlibs-dev, x11proto-xext-dev | xlibs-dev, libfreetype6-dev | freetype2-dev, libbz2-dev, libltdl3-dev, automake1.7 | automaken, libtool, debhelper (>= 4.0)
 Standards-Version: 3.5.7.0
 
 Package: imlib2-demo
@@ -39,6 +39,6 @@
 Architecture: any
 Section: libdevel
 Architecture: any
-Depends: libimlib2 (= ${Source-Version}), libjpeg62-dev, libpng3-dev | libpng2-dev | libpng-dev, libtiff4-dev | libtiff-dev, zlib1g-dev, libttf-dev, libungif4-dev | libungif3g-dev | giflib3g-dev, xlibs-dev, libfreetype6-dev | freetype2-dev, libbz2-dev
+Depends: libimlib2 (= ${Source-Version}), libjpeg62-dev, libpng3-dev | libpng2-dev | libpng-dev, libtiff4-dev | libtiff-dev, zlib1g-dev, libttf-dev, libungif4-dev | libungif3g-dev | giflib3g-dev, x11proto-core-dev | xlibs-dev, x11proto-xext-dev | xlibs-dev, libfreetype6-dev | freetype2-dev, libbz2-dev
 Description: Imlib2 headers, static libraries and documentation
  Headers, static libraries and documentation for Imlib2.
--- control.org	2006-05-28 21:40:24.000000000 +0200
+++ control	2006-05-28 21:46:56.000000000 +0200
@@ -2,7 +2,7 @@
 Section: libs
 Priority: optional
 Maintainer: Sytse Wielinga <s.b.wielinga@student.utwente.nl>
-Build-Depends: debhelper (>> 4.0.0), libimlib2-dev, libedb1-dev, libeet0-dev, xlibs-dev, libfreetype6-dev, automake1.7 | automaken, libtool
+Build-Depends: debhelper (>> 4.0.0), libimlib2-dev, libedb1-dev, libeet0-dev, libfreetype6-dev, automake1.7 | automaken, libtool
 Standards-Version: 3.5.8.0
 
 Package: imlib2-loaders